The church has waited long

by Horatius Bonar

Representative text

As printed in The Seventh-day Adventist Hymnal (1985), no. 217.

Verse 1

The church has waited long Her absent Lord to see; And still in loneliness she waits, A friendless stranger she.

Verse 2

How long, O Lord our God, Holy and true and good, Wilt Thou not judge Thy suffering church, Her sighs and tears and blood?

Verse 3

We long to hear Thy voice, To see Thee face to face, To share Thy crown and glory then, As now we share Thy grace.

Verse 4

Come, Lord, and wipe away The curse, the sin, the stain, And make this blighted world of ours Thine own fair world again.
